ToolsOptionsBaseControl<TOptions> 클래스

정의

도구 메뉴, 옵션 하위 메뉴의 탭 중 하나에 표시되는 사용자 정의 컨트롤의 기본 클래스입니다.

generic <typename TOptions>
public ref class ToolsOptionsBaseControl : Microsoft::SqlServer::Management::UI::VSIntegration::Editors::ToolsOptionsBaseUserControl
public class ToolsOptionsBaseControl<TOptions> : Microsoft.SqlServer.Management.UI.VSIntegration.Editors.ToolsOptionsBaseUserControl
type ToolsOptionsBaseControl<'Options> = class
    inherit ToolsOptionsBaseUserControl
Public Class ToolsOptionsBaseControl(Of TOptions)
Inherits ToolsOptionsBaseUserControl

형식 매개 변수

TOptions

옵션 제네릭 클래스의 유형입니다.

상속
ToolsOptionsBaseControl<TOptions>

생성자

ToolsOptionsBaseControl<TOptions>()

ToolsOptionsBaseControl<TOptions> 클래스의 새 인스턴스를 초기화합니다.

속성

Current

도구 메뉴, 옵션 하위 메뉴의 탭 중 하나에 표시되는 사용자 정의 컨트롤을 가져옵니다.

메서드

ApplyChanges()

변경된 설정을 적용합니다.

ApplyChanges(TOptions)

변경된 설정을 적용합니다.

CancelChanges()

변경 내용을 취소합니다.

Initialize(TOptions)

컨트롤을 초기화합니다.

InitializeControls()

컨트롤을 초기화합니다.

ResetChanges()

변경 내용을 다시 설정합니다.

SaveOrCompareCurrentValueOfControls(Boolean)

컨트롤 값을 저장하거나 비교합니다.

ValidateNumeric(NumericUpDown, String)

지정된 숫자 컨트롤의 현재 값에 대해 유효성을 검사하고 값이 잘못된 경우 메시지를 표시합니다.

ValidateValuesInControls()

컨트롤의 유효성을 검사합니다.

(다음에서 상속됨 ToolsOptionsBaseUserControl)

적용 대상